site stats

Genetic algorithm maximize function python

WebApr 22, 2024 · Before we create individuals, each individual needs to have a fitness value for which we will define the class FitnessMin.It will inherit the Fitness class of the deap.base module and contains an attribute called … WebJan 10, 2024 · A genetic algorithm is a process of natural selection for the optimal value of problems. Code: In the following code, we will import some libraries by which we can select the features with the help of the genetic selection function. data = load_breast_cancer () is used to load the breast cancer dataset.

Simple Genetic Algorithm From Scratch in Python

Web• A genetic algorithm (or GA) is a search technique used in computing to find true or approximate solutions to optimization and search problems. • (GA)s are categorized as global search heuristics. • (GA)s are a particular class of evolutionary algorithms that use techniques inspired by evolutionary biology such as inheritance, WebCompare the best free open source BSD Genetic Algorithms at SourceForge. Free, secure and fast BSD Genetic Algorithms downloads from the largest Open Source applications and software directory the happy cheese ashurst https://tontinlumber.com

Introducing GeneAl: a Genetic Algorithm Python Library

WebJun 24, 2024 · GeneAl is a python library implementing Genetic Algorithms, which can be used and adapted to solve many optimization problems. One can use the provided out-of-the-box solver classes — BinaryGenAlgSolver and ContinuousGenAlgSolver — , or create a custom class which inherits from one of these, and implements methods that override the … WebOct 12, 2024 · Optimization involves finding the inputs to an objective function that result in the minimum or maximum output of the function. The open-source Python library for scientific computing called SciPy provides a suite of optimization algorithms. Many of the algorithms are used as a building block in other algorithms, most notably machine … WebGenetic Algorithms (GAs) are members of a general class of optimization algorithms, known as Evolutionary Algorithms (EAs), which simulate a fictional enviro... the happy chemical in brain

Optimization using Genetic Algorithm/Evolutionary Algorithm in Python …

Category:Genetic Algorithm Implementation in Python by Ahmed …

Tags:Genetic algorithm maximize function python

Genetic algorithm maximize function python

Transportation Problem — Solve using Genetic Algorithm

WebMay 30, 2024 · In evolutionary algorithms terminology solution vectors are called chromosomes, their coordinates are called genes, and value of objective function is called fitness. Amply commented python code ... WebMar 18, 2024 · This tutorial explains the usage of the genetic algorithm for optimizing the network weights of an Artificial Neural Network for improved performance. By Ahmed Gad, KDnuggets Contributor on March 18, …

Genetic algorithm maximize function python

Did you know?

WebApr 30, 2024 · If you want to maximize objective with minimize you should set the sign parameter to -1. See the maximization example in scipy documentation. minimize assumes that the value returned by a constraint function is greater than zero. WebAug 30, 2016 · Yes, you could change the sign of both functions and then use any multi-objective optimization algorithm like NSGA-II to obtain the pareto front. For a nontrivial multi-objective optimization ...

Implementation of Genetic Algorithm in Python. Let’s try to implement the genetic algorithm in python for function optimization. Problem Statement. Let consider that we have an equation, f(x) = -x² + 5 . We need the solution for which it has the maximum value and the constraint is 0≤x≤31. To select an initial … See more At the beginning of this process, we need to initialize some possible solutions to this problem. The population is a subset of all possible solutions to … See more After initializing the population, we need to calculate the fitness value of these chromosomes. Now the question is what this fitness function is and how it calculates the fitness value. As an example, let consider … See more Crossover is used to vary the programming of the chromosomes from one generation to another by creating children or offsprings. Parent chromosomes are … See more Parent selection is done by using the fitness values of the chromosomes calculated by the fitness function. Based on these fitness values we need to select a pair chromosomes with the highest fitness value. There … See more WebDec 19, 2024 · sumOfSquaredError (parameterTuple) - function to minimize by the genetic algorithm generate_Initial_Parameters () - generate initial parameters based on SciPy's genetic algorithm Then what I do is to use the main function which has a pandas.DataFrame as an input.

WebThis overview shows the three main steps of our method for empirical data collection and evaluation. Different search variants and genetic control parameter combinations can be selected in the Test Generator Configuration.Next, Test Case Generation & Execution automatically optimizes test cases towards critical roads, combining genetic algorithm … WebTo maximize the control efficacy of a DRL algorithm, an optimized reward shaping function and a solid hyperparameter combination are essential. In order to achieve optimal control during the powered descent guidance (PDG) landing phase of a reusable launch vehicle, the Deep Deterministic Policy Gradient (DDPG) algorithm is used in this paper …

WebApr 12, 2024 · The Python 3.10.4 version was used for implementing the genetic algorithm in this study. This choice was made as it is one of the most recent and stable versions of Python, offering improved performance, enhanced features, and better library support, which ensures reliable and efficient execution of the algorithm.

WebPyGAD - Python Genetic Algorithm!¶ PyGAD is an open-source Python library for building the genetic algorithm and optimizing machine learning algorithms. It works with Keras and PyTorch. PyGAD supports different types of crossover, mutation, and parent selection operators. PyGAD allows different types of problems to be optimized using the … thehappyco.comWebgenetic algorithm Python · No attached data sources. genetic algorithm. Notebook. Input. Output. Logs. Comments (2) Run. 11.2s. history Version 2 of 2. License. This Notebook has been released under the Apache 2.0 open source license. Continue exploring. Data. 1 input and 0 output. arrow_right_alt. Logs. 11.2 second run - successful. the battle of the ancreWebSome heuristics, and two metaheuristics, an ant colony optimization algorithm and a genetic algorithm are developed and tested on various random data. The proposed ant colony optimization method ... the battle of the alamo summaryWebMar 19, 2024 · Genetic algorithm to maximize result of a function Ask Question Asked today Modified today Viewed 4 times 0 I have a function F (a, b, c, d) = X , a b c and d being parameters with the following constraints: 5 < a < 200 1 < b < 100 c > 0.05 the happy chocolatier acton maWeb3. Backtesting with Genetic Algorithm Optimization. In this part, we will use the backtest function with the genetic algorithm optimization to backtest the portfolio on the test set. … the battle of the argonne forest 1918WebMay 18, 2024 · We need a function to check this and this function can be called a fitness function. Our fitness function is that we subtract the result by 30 and we check the difference value, the more the ... the battle of the bands 2022WebMay 23, 2024 · def rouletteWheelSelect (population): fitnessSum = 0 for individual in population: fitnessSum += individual.fitness for individual in population: individual.selectProb = individual.fitness / fitnessSum probSum = 0 wheelProbList = [] if MAXIMIZATION_PROBLEM: for individual in population: probSum += … the battle of the badge